PODD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2020 in Review

386 of the 4,538 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Insulet (PODD) for Q1 2020, worth a combined $11B — down 3% from $11.4B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 71 funds opened new PODD positions and 54 closed out — a net gain of 17 holders — while 129 added to existing stakes and 136 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Capital World Investors, adding an estimated $265M. The largest seller was Primecap Management, cutting an estimated $137M.
